AI risk management in transport

AI risk in transport is not abstract. It affects vehicles, passengers, safety, and compliance. Boards that do not understand the specific risks are approving technology they cannot oversee.

Risk is something transport boards already understand. You manage safety risk, operational risk, regulatory risk, and financial risk every day. AI adds a new category, but the principles are the same. Understand what can go wrong, put measures in place to prevent it, and plan for what happens when it does.

The problem is that AI risk is often treated as a technology problem rather than a business risk. It is not. It is the same kind of risk you already manage, with the added complication that the system can change its own behaviour over time.

This article breaks down the specific risks AI creates in transport, how to categorise them, and what the board should be asking.

The categories of AI risk in transport

AI risk in transport falls into five categories. None of them are new in principle, but they need new attention because AI changes the way they show up.

  1. Safety risk. The AI makes a decision that affects vehicle or passenger safety.
  2. Operational risk. The AI makes a decision that disrupts the transport operation.
  3. Regulatory risk. The AI creates a compliance problem the business did not have before.
  4. Financial risk. The AI costs more than it saves, or creates losses through bad decisions.
  5. Reputational risk. The AI makes a decision that damages customer trust or public confidence.

Safety risk is the one that matters most in transport. An AI system that recommends a vehicle is safe to operate when it is not, or that schedules maintenance incorrectly, or that routes a vehicle through an unsafe area, creates risk that is physical and visible. That is different from an AI system in finance that makes a bad prediction. In transport, the consequences are on the road.

Operational risk is about disruption. A system that reroutes vehicles incorrectly, miscalculates capacity, or misaligns schedules creates operational chaos. The cost is measured in late deliveries, empty vehicles, and wasted fuel.

Regulatory risk is growing. Transport is regulated, and those regulations are changing to include AI. If the AI system makes a decision that breaches a regulation, the business is responsible. The system did not know the rule. The business was supposed to.

Financial risk is the one most boards focus on first. Does the AI save money or cost money? The honest answer is usually both, at different times. The risk is that the costs come before the savings, and the savings do not materialise at the scale promised.

Reputational risk is the one that lingers. A safety incident, a compliance breach, or a visible failure in service quality that is attributed to AI damages trust. Rebuilding that trust takes longer than fixing the technology.

How to categorise risk

Not all AI uses carry the same risk. A system that analyses fuel consumption data carries lower risk than a system that decides which vehicles to put on the road. A system that generates compliance reports carries lower risk than one that submits them automatically.

The board needs a simple framework for categorising risk. Fuzzelogic's approach is to classify every AI use by what happens if it fails. If the failure is an inconvenience, it is low risk. If it disrupts operations, it is medium risk. If it affects safety or compliance, it is high risk.

What the board should ask

The board does not need to understand the technology to manage the risk. It needs to ask the right questions.

First, what does the system decide? Not what it recommends. What it actually decides and acts on. The difference matters.

Second, what happens when it is wrong? What is the fallback? Who is affected? How quickly can the error be detected and corrected?

Third, who monitors the system? Not who built it. Who watches it every day, checks its decisions, and reports problems?

Fourth, what has changed since it was approved? AI systems change as they learn from new data. The system that was approved three months ago may behave differently today.
